Transaction

77997342e71c282d2dbd7f3672f3167835d01d189e7e8ada8a65cb4a7aebe88f

Summary

In Block208158
TimeThu, 01 Jun 2023 11:41:00 UTC
Total Input2460.47578624 Nebula
Total Output2515.47578624 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
754874 Confirmations2515.47578624 Nebula
Raw Transaction